public Boolean getIsActiveNowBoolean() {
int effectiveVal = (getAuthorizationEffectiveDate() == null) ? 0 : 1;
int expirationVal = (getAuthorizationExpirationDate() == null) ? 0 : 2;
long nowMillis = (new Date()).getTime();
boolean returnVal = false;
switch(effectiveVal + expirationVal)
{
case 0: // both are null
returnVal = true;
break;
case 1: // effectiveDate is not null
if(nowMillis > getAuthorizationEffectiveDate().getTime())
returnVal = true;
else
returnVal = false;
break;
case 2: // expirationDate is not null
if(nowMillis < getAuthorizationExpirationDate().getTime())
returnVal = true;
else
returnVal = false;
break;
case 3: // both effectiveDate and expirationDate are not null
if((nowMillis > getAuthorizationEffectiveDate().getTime()) &&
(nowMillis < getAuthorizationExpirationDate().getTime()))
returnVal = true;
else
returnVal = false;
break;
}
return Boolean.valueOf(returnVal);
}
